Analysis

In 2024, share of all students in secondary education enrolled in general in UNICEF: Middle East and North Africa Programme Countries stood at 87.9%.

That represents a change of up 0.2% on the previous year and down 0.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, share of all students in secondary education enrolled in general in UNICEF: Middle East and North Africa Programme Countries peaked at 90.1% in 1972 and was at its lowest, 86.3%, in 2004.

UNICEF: Middle East and North Africa Programme Countries ranks 132nd of 221 groups on this measure, in the middle of the range.
